Michelle Geib

Principal at North Light IT

After 10 years in corporate retail, Michelle transitioned to the IT industry over 15 years ago. She manages the daily operations for North Light IT and touches everything from finance to human resources. Michelle has a Bachelors of Science in Business Administration and enjoys traveling and exploring new places.

Timeline

  • Principal

    Current role